<p><span style="font-size: small;">The Sarojin, Thailand’s award-winning 56 boutique residence property, has won the <strong><em>2009 Wine Spectator Award of Excellence </em></strong>for the second consecutive year. This prestigious accolade was awarded to the resort’s signature restaurant, <em>Ficus,</em> for demonstrating a dedication to wine, a well-chosen selection of quality wine producers, and a thematic match with its menu items in both price and style.</span></p>
<p><span style="font-size: small;"><span id="more-1469"></span></span><span style="font-size: small;">The Sarojin features an extraordinary wine cellar with over 200 vintages from both the old and new worlds. This is complemented by the availability of 20 wines by the glass &#8211; <em>Le Verre de Vin,</em> the world&#8217;s most advanced wine and champagne preservation system. <em>Le Verre de Vin</em> is capable of preserving an unlimited number of still, sparkling and fortified wines and is available at The Sarojin’s <em>Ficus </em>and <em>Edge</em> restaurants. The Sarojin’s Wine Director, Sam Bonifant, shares his passion for wine with the resort’s British owners, Kate and Andrew Kemp; together they have created an award-winning wine list that emphasises quality and affordability and which perfectly complements the restaurants’ à la carte cuisine.</span></p>
<p><span style="font-size: small;">Comments Kate Kemp, “We’re very proud of our wine selection and pay great attention to vintage, proper storage, appropriate food pairing and serving, criteria that are particularly important in maintaining fine wines in a tropical climate. Wine Spectator’s 2009 Award of Excellence is testament to our dedication in providing the very best and to the very positive feedback that we receive from our guests.” </span></p>
<p><span style="font-size: small;">Adds Sam Bonifant, “You can have the best wine in the world but if it is exposed to the heat for too long the result can be a total disaster. Also, the old principles of what wine went best with which dish, were really quite limited. We constantly challenge ourselves to pair the best selection with the myriad of flavours offered by the quality of our cuisine.”</span></p>
<p><span style="font-size: small;">Complementing the wine menu is The Sarojin’s à la carte cuisine, a delectable choice of Asian and continental dishes, prepared by Executive Chef Khun Jui and his team. Enhancing The Sarojin’s culinary offerings is the resort’s ability to stage extraordinary dining experiences “just for 2,” engineered by their very own <em>Imagineer</em>, Jowell Philemond-Montout. As the ultimate personal concierge, Jowell works with the chefs to turn guests’ culinary desires into reality, creating tailor-made settings for even greater appeal and enjoyment; for example, guests can choose from a candlelit degustation dinner by a waterfall, or around the resort’s ancient <em>Ficus</em> tree; a private beach barbecue by the Andaman Sea; Thai culinary cooking lessons along the Takuapa River; a delicious lunch at one of the pool island pavilions, or an intimate gourmet dinner in the privacy of their own private dining sala. For the more adventurous, gourmet safari-style breakfasts and lunches can be arranged for day excursions in one of the five national parks bordering The Sarojin, or for a decadent day at sea, couples can indulge in a champagne and oyster spread on board the resort’s Lady Sarojin luxury charter yacht.</span></p>
<p><span style="font-size: small;">The 2009 Wine Spectator Award for Excellence is indicative of The Sarojin’s exceptional level of personalised service and attention to detail. The resort’s name is inspired by the mythical Lady Sarojin, the daughter of a prominent Thai nobleman who was regarded as the perfect host and whose household became famous for its hospitality.  The Sarojin’s goal is to reflect this legacy by providing an experience that is reminiscent of staying at a friend’s private estate. It is located directly on a secluded 7 mile white sand beach, just 55 minutes drive north of Phuket Airport and 7km north of Khao Lak centre in the Phang Nga province of Thailand. Children under 12 years are not permitted to stay at The Sarojin.</span></p>

<p>The Sarojin Thailand has created a six night Luxurious Honeymoon Experience, designed to provide a level of personalised service and hospitality that makes the honeymoon just as special as the wedding day.<span id="more-1010"></span> A deluxe holiday experience, it is a wonderfully indulgent romantic retreat and priced from approximately AUD 3,230 per couple, (Thai Baht 87,230) the Luxurious Honeymoon Experience includes the extras that make such an occasion truly memorable.</p>
<p>It begins with a luxury private car transfer from Phuket airport, with refreshments and cold towels on hand during the 55 minutes journey to the resort. Upon arrival, guests are escorted to one of 56 beautifully decorated guest residences, where a chilled complimentary bottle of sparkling wine awaits, together with flowers and a basket laden with Thailand’s exotic fruits.  Included in the package, and to be arranged at your convenience, is a private Candlelit Jungle Waterfall Dinner Experience “just for 2”, as well as a 90 minute Royal Oriental Spa treatment at The Sarojin’s award winning Pathways Spa, and daily a la carte breakfast with sparkling wine.</p>
<p>The Candlelit Jungle Waterfall Dinner is something special for any couple, with the romance of the setting heightened by its ethereal beauty; a guided walk down a candlelit jungle path leads to a waterfall setting lit by hundreds of candles. Against this backdrop is a beautifully adorned dinner table, replete with a personal chef, ready and waiting to prepare an exquisite gourmet experience. The Pathways spa, hidden by mangroves but set above the estuary with views toward the Andaman sea, provides an oasis of well-being where trained therapists help to relax and re-balance body and soul.</p>
<p>The Sarojin’s unique style of hospitality is further enhanced by its very own Imagineer, an ultimate personal concierge whose expertise and imagination helps turn guests’ wishes into reality. Jowell Philemond-Montout is The Sarojin’s Imagineer and his in-depth knowledge of the hidden treasures of the surrounding five national parks, combined with the amenities of The Sarojin, allow him full reign to create unique guest experiences. In addition to creating the most romantic deluxe dinners “a deux”, he engineers private barbecues in extraordinary settings, Thai cooking classes by jungle rivers, waterfalls and beaches, and facilitates fabulous trips on the Lady Sarojin yacht, that include snorkeling and cruising amongst the world famous Similan Islands and sea canoeing in stunning Phang Nga Bay.</p>
<p>The Sarojin’s guest residences are far more than a guestroom. Each one features its own private gardens and “sala” sundeck, couples’ baths with waterfall showers, and plunge and relaxation pools that blend into the natural habitat. Should the need arise to re-connect with the outside world, The Sarojin offers complimentary Wi-Fi internet access in all residences and throughout the resort. There is also a well stocked boutique shop and library with books, CDs and DVDs. Other complimentary facilities include a fully equipped fitness centre and mountain bikes, sailing catamarans, sail boats, sea kayaks and windsurfers.  Khao Lak town is just 10 minutes away and readily accessible via a regular complimentary daily return trip shuttle service.</p>
<p>Guests can enjoy additional benefits through to 31 Oct 2009 including free nights based on a minimum of 2 nights booked; for example, stay 4 nights, pay 2 nights; stay 6 nights pay 3 nights. Plus, now through to 20 December 2009 and 11 Jan – 20 Dec 2010, guests that stay 6 nights or more in a Sarojin Suite can enjoy a 4 hour Nature’s Midday Haven per person, or 60 minutes spa treatment and half day elephant trek.</p>
<p>The Sarojin’s name is inspired by the mythical Lady Sarojin, the daughter of a prominent Thai nobleman who was regarded as the perfect host and whose household became famous for its hospitality.  The Sarojin’s goal is to reflect this legacy by providing an experience that is reminiscent of staying at a friend’s private estate. It is located directly on a secluded 7 mile white sand beach, just 55 minutes drive north of Phuket Airport and 7km north of Khao Lak centre in the Phang Nga province of Thailand. Children under 12 years are not permitted to stay at The Sarojin.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><img style="float: left;" title="Away Chumphon" src="http://uniquetourism.com/news/wp-content/uploads/2009/03/away-chumphon-300x200.jpg" alt="Away Chumphon" width="200" />Away Resorts Thailand, one of the four brands of Astudo Hotel and Resort Management, proudly announces the launch of the “Experience Real Thailand” at their Away Tusita Resort in Chumphon, located on the beautiful unspoiled beach of Had Arunothai in one of the most unique provinces in Thailand.<span id="more-595"></span></p>
<p>Due to the growing number of tourists demanding authentic holidays with a genuine Thai cultural experience, Away Tusita resort owner Khun Teerawut is hoping to exploit this niche and develop a new approach to excursions in Chumphon. Teerawut observed that “there is more to Thailand than sitting on the beach, so at Away Tusita Resort we have created a new concept to provide our guests with more of a ‘hands on experience’ to learn the true nature of Thai culture”. The innovative programs will offer guests a wide choice of activities and cultural insights ranging from fruit carving to night fishing and will go beyond the usual activities and tours to give tourists a deeper perspective into the Thai way of life.</p>
<p>With the ‘Experience Real Thailand’ guests of Away Tusita can now experience it firsthand themselves with active participation and emersion into the local communities and population. Night fishing from a boat with real Thai fishermen; exploring the life of a Thai monk by visiting a local temple; visiting a rubber or coffee plantation to experience the interesting methods of these ancient processes or cycling to the local villages and temples to experience the real local life in the neighbouring village Paktako.</p>
<p>These are alternation options of the extended program of activities around the province for guest to join every day during their stay at this stunning resort. A unique holiday opportunity to learn, feel and love Thailand in a deeper way than ever before.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Astudo Hotel &amp; Resort Management&#8217;s portfolio has been expanding rapidly across Thailand over the last two years. After successfully launching a increasing number of resort properties under its X2, Away and Le Bayburi brands, Astudo has the proudly presents her latest development Away Maerim, Chiang Mai.<span id="more-371"></span></p>
<p>Away Maerim, Chiang Mai, set on 25 Rai (40,000 square meters), is ideally located in the tranquil Mae Rim valley. This superb property provides the finest relaxation, a spa and excellent food and beverages. Understated rooms in huge sub-tropical surroundings offer lovely views over the surrounding mountains and a sense of calmness. A perfect place to relax and rejuvenate or to explore the well known Mae-Rim Valley.</p>
<p>The resort offers a combination of 7 different types of accommodation with a total of 42 rooms. The standard room facilities include individually controlled air conditioning, a mini bar, a personal safe and hairdryer, tea &amp; coffee making facilities, DVD &amp; CD player and satellite TV.</p>
<p>Away resorts are the epitome of peaceful hideaways. All resorts offer guests every opportunity to truly slow down and enjoy their holiday but at the same time provide an interesting and unique array of activities and tours to provide a perfect balance for your holiday. A key hallmark of Away Resorts is their relaxed casual atmosphere, blended with high levels of individual service.</p>
<p>The grand opening of Away Maerim, Chiang Mai will be on the 12<sup>th</sup> December 2008 with the amazing offer &#8220;buy 1 night get 1 night free&#8221;, available from now until the 31<sup>st</sup> of January 2009.</p>
<p>About Astudo Hotel &amp; Resort Management</p>
<p>Astudo Hotel &amp; Resort Management operates and manages X2 Resorts (<a href="http://www.x2resorts.com/">www.X2resorts.com</a>), Away Resorts (<a href="http://www.awayresorts.com/">www.awayresorts.com</a>) and Le Bayburi (<a href="http://www.lebayburi.com/">www.lebayburi.com</a>). Away Resorts tend to be designed in a simple but comfortable manner with a distinctive tropical Polynesian theme and traditional Thai hospitality. The first Away resort opened in October 2007 in Koh Kood, followed by Away Tusita Chumphon in September 2008 and Away Suan-Sawan Mae-Rim, Chiang Mai in November 2008. Away Koh Phangan and Away Koh Samui are scheduled to open late 2009.</p>
